Resumo
This article proposes an analysis of the political and legal aspects of the Right to the City from the perspective of the concept of public sphere. The Right to the City is interpreted as a dynamic link between political mobilization, democratization of social relations and of the State’s institutional apparatus, and the guarantee of better material conditions of existence in the urban space. Based on a bibliographical research about the theme of urban social struggles in Brazil and in the city of São Paulo, the article intends to demonstrate that the Right to the City is exercised by the population through clashes in the public sphere, which are responsible for stimulating the renewal of the legal order and for attributing new meanings to the existing Law.
